When does a Mira Mesa home need emergency electrical service?

  • Sparks, smoke, or flames from an outlet, switch, or panel
  • Burning plastic smell anywhere in the house
  • No power to half the house and the breakers haven't tripped
  • Outlet or switch is hot to the touch
  • Service line down on the property after a storm or tree fall
  • Main breaker tripped and won't reset
  • Water intrusion at the panel or service equipment

What counts as an electrical emergency?

Anything with smoke, sparks, fire, burning smell, or hot electrical components. Anything with potential injury: exposed wires, downed lines, water at the panel. Total or partial power loss with no obvious cause. When in doubt, call. We'll triage on the phone.
